Pakinomist – Prominent supporter and executive chairman of MicroStrategy, Michael Saylor, recently said that Bitcoin is worth all the money in the world. Saylor continues to back up his sentiment with action, regularly adding Bitcoin to MicroStrategy’s holdings when liquidity allows, despite the fact that such a statement may seem overly dramatic. Recent acquisitions show mixed performance when examining MicroStrategy’s Bitcoin purchase history.

A total of 2,530 BTC were purchased on January 13, 2025 at an average price of $95,972 per coin. Other recent acquisitions paint a different picture, although the acquisition currently shows a modest profit of $3.06 million (1.5%). An example of how erratic these investments can be is the purchase on December 23, 2024 of 5,252 Bitcoin at a price of $106,862 per coin, which led to a loss of $48 million.

MicroStrategy has established itself as one of the largest institutional Bitcoin holders over the years. However, this aggressive accumulation strategy has always paid off in the short term, as the company has often suffered from fluctuations. Saylor’s belief in Bitcoin’s long-term value is evident in his unwavering confidence in the cryptocurrency despite this.
